Coconut rice, chicken, roasted broccoli, chilli fried egg, dill and a side of nuoc cham.
Coconut rice
Rice in a pan with a tin of low fat coconut milk and a half cup of water, along with a pinch of salt. Cook it medium heat until rice is soft. If you need more liquid, add a splash of water. When it’s done, it should be sticky and SO TASTY!
Chicken
2 teaspoons paprika
1 teaspoon turmeric
1 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per
1 teaspoon ground coriander
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
1/4 teaspoon cayenne powder

I butterflied two chicken breasts, and cook it in a splash of @broightergoldrapeseedoil when it was sealed, I added the seasoning and let it cook away until cooked

Chilli fried egg
-
In a pan, add some @broightergoldrapeseedoil and @sriracha_fg, let it heat. Then crack in an egg and let it cook low and slow. You want this to be runny. Sprinkle a tiny amount of @maldonsalt on your yolk.
Nuoc Cham
-
This. Is. Unreal.
1/4 cup fish sauce
1/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up warm water
1 lime
Chillies for heat
-
In a bowl add the sugar and water. Stir until sugar has dissolved. Add the fish sauce and juice of one lime. Add your chillies, and stir.
